St Peter & St Paul, Lavenham, Suffolk - 30th September 2005
THE EAST WINDOW IN THE LADY CHAPEL

The east window in the Lady Chapel, of fine Victorian glass, shows in the upper light Jesus blessing children dressed in both in costume from the time of Christ and the 16th century, when the chapel was built.  Below is the incident described in Matthew 26 when a woman anoints Jesus' feet with costly ointment and wipes them with her hair.  This takes place in the house of Simon the leper in Bethany.  Judas is shown, extreme right, with his bag containing the thirty pieces of silver, the reward for his betrayal.
